首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

联合评测 | GreatSQL 开源数据库在 DapuStor Roealsen5 NVMe SSD 中的应用探索

3、测试用例设计 sysbench测试: 数据库的 InnoDB Buffer Pool size 通常最高设置为物理内存的75%,但实际生产服务器实际内存大小存在差异,导致生产环境的 InnoDB Buffer...和友商在 ibp=96G 混合读写场景 QPS 对比(越高越好) 图4:Roealsen5和友商在 ibp=96G 混合读写场景平均时延对比(越低越好) 图5:Roealsen5 和友商在 ibp=144G...混合读写场景 QPS 对比(越高越好) 图6:Roealsen5 和友商在 ibp=144G 混合读写场景平均时延对比(越低越好) 图7:Roealsen5 和友商在 ibp=192G 混合读写场景...和友商在 ibp=96G 混合读写场景 QPS 对比(越高越好) 图12:Roealsen5和友商在ibp=96G 混合读写场景平均时延对比(越低越好) 图13:Roealsen5和友商在ibp=144G...混合读写场景QPS 对比(越高越好) 图14:Roealsen5 和友商在 ibp=144G 混合读写场景平均时延对比(越低越好) 图15:Roealsen5 和友商在 ibp=192G 混合读写场景

86430
您找到你想要的搜索结果了吗?
是的
没有找到

云计算耗电惊人占全球用电量的8%

“云计算”目前已经应用于许多企业,尤其是一些高科技企业,以谷歌、亚马逊等科技巨头为例,数据存储在数据中心里数以千计的“云端”服务器中。尽管最近数年服务器的硬盘空间大幅增长,但云计算仍然面临挑战。...对数据中心高密度的服务器进行冷却,也需要大量能源。未来数年,伴随着云计算需求的快速增长,能耗也将水涨船高。...在亚马逊的云计算服务AmazonWeb Services的能耗中,清洁能源占15%,其余来自煤炭、核电和天然气。...美国用的是核电,因此,特斯拉在美国每公里碳排放大概是122g,无疑是环保节能车型。但中国大量使用煤电,算下来,特斯拉的碳排放约为175g/公里,而传统的汽油车大概是150g或160g/公里左右。...去年惠普推出了新款低能耗服务器,能耗比传统服务器低89%。该清洁能源公司已经开发了一项液冷技术,提升数据中心现有设备的运行效率。这项液冷技术使数据中心无需配备高能耗的风扇和空调设备。

4.3K40

Apache Doris 2.0.0 版本正式发布:盲测性能 10 倍提升,更统一多样的极速分析体验

高效的数据更新一直是大数据分析领域的痛点,离线数据仓库 Hive 通常支持分区级别的数据更新,而 Hudi 和 Iceberg 等数据湖,虽然支持 Record 级别更新,但是通常采用 Merge-on-Read...使用 insert into select 对 TPC-H 144G lineitem 表进行导入 48 buckets Duplicate 表,吞吐量提升 50%。...Segment 文件过多问题,资源消耗降低 90%,速度提升 50%,内存占用仅为原先的 10% 。...图片通过将 Query 与 Workload Group 相关联,可以限制单个 Query 在 BE 节点上的 CPU 和内存资源的百分比,并可以配置开启资源组的内存软限制。...当集群资源紧张时,将自动 Kill 组内占用内存最大的若干个查询任务以减缓集群压力。

55751

八百元八核的服务器?二手服务器(工作站)搭建指南(下)| 你们要的第二弹

2U机架式双路服务器;支持55、56家族CPU;最大144G DDR3内存(G7是192G),支持RECC;8个2.5寸 SAS/SATA(G7支持SSD)热插拔盘位;集成P410i阵列卡,带256缓存...但由于不支持RECC内存,性价比较低,这里不详细介绍。 这里我们详细介绍支持RECC的工作站。 HP Z600:1600元左右。5520芯片组双路1366工作站。...也就是说,“正显”是指系统能正确识别出型号的QS,这些CPU往往是最靠后的一到两批工程样品,和正式版的全部已经非常非常小了。...其他的知识(比如如何识别ES CPU具体型号、步进)大家可以参考这篇文章:http://tieba.baidu.com/p/4727549317?...2、双路功耗高(当然你也可以上单路)。 3、开机慢,自检1分半左右。

10.3K121

cookie 与 session区别与用法

也就是说服务器不会自动维护名为JSESSIONID的Cookie了,但是程序中仍然可以读写其他的Cookie。 永久登录 在登录时查询一次数据库,以后访问验证登录信息时不再查询数据库。...session登录 Session保存在服务器端。为了获得更高的存取速度,服务器一般把Session放在内存里。每个用户都会有一个独立的Session。...如果Session内容过于复杂,当大量客户访问服务器时可能会导致内存溢出。因此,Session里的信息应该尽量精简。...虽然Session保存在服务器,对客户端是透明的,它的正常运行仍然需要客户端浏览器的支持。这是因为Session需要使用Cookie作为识别标志。...Session在用户第一次访问服务器的时候自动创建。需要注意只有访问JSP、Servlet等程序时才会创建Session,访问HTML、IMAGE等静态资源并不会创建Session。

1.1K30

用少于256KB内存实现边缘训练,开销不到PyTorch千分之一

说到神经网络训练,大家的第一印象都是 GPU + 服务器 + 云平台。传统的训练由于其巨大的内存开销,往往是云端进行训练而边缘平台仅负责推理。...例如,微调语言模型让其能从输入历史中学习;调整视觉模型使得智能相机能够不断识别新的物体。...再者,现有的低成本高效转移学习算法,例如训练最后一层分类器 (last FC),进行学习 bias 项,往往准确率都不尽如人意,无法用于实践,更不用说现有的深度学习框架无法将这些算法的理论数字转化为实测的节省...最后,现代深度训练框架(PyTorch,TensorFlow)通常是为云服务器设计的,即便把 batch-size 设置为 1,训练小模型 (MobileNetV2-w0.35) 也需要大量的内存占用。...),但如果更新最后一层,最后的精度又难免差强人意。

50040

自动化测试解决验证码问题

短信验证码做了手工测试,当时想的是短信验证码需要一台手机,并且能够发送验证码,由于当时没有做移动端的任何测试,考虑到成本问题只能在自动化测试是放弃这种登录验证方式,保证功能在手工测试时正常通过; 然后在登陆时选择邮件发送验证码...1、存储在本进程内存中:服务器生成验证码后,即将验证码存储在服务器中,一般以session方式进行存储。...优点:性能好 缺点:扩展性查、占用服务器内存 如何测试:其他进程是访问不到服务进程的,只能在开发时服务进程内增加验证码查询接口,以方便验证,上线时,将此接口移除或禁用。...其三:验证码识别技术 例如可以通过 Python-tesseract等技术来识别图片验证码,Python-tesseract 是光学字符识别 Tesseract OCR 引擎的 Python 封装类。...不过,目前市面上的验证码形式繁多,目前任何一种验证码识别技术,识别率都不是 100% 。 目前有很多专门做验证码识别技术的,毕竟术业有专攻,也是不错之选,毕竟自己造轮子不大可取。

2.8K40

到底什么是调优

Heap 中老年代的持续增长触摸到内存红线Full GC 次数过多,GC 停顿时间太久解决 OOM本地缓存占用太多内存空间系统整体吞吐量不高而一些原则也是需要明确的:多数的 Java 应用其实并不需要在服务器上进行...然后确定调优参数,应用到一台服务器,观察,之后再应用到所有的所有的服务器。...参数:分类可以简单的分为三类: "-"开头的参数、"-X"开头的参数、"-XX"开头的参数;"-X"开头的参数是非标准参数,只能被部分VM识别,而不能被全部VM识别的参数;"-XX"开头的参数是非稳定参数...通常来说,分析堆内存快照(Heap Dump)是一个很好的定位手段,如果发生内存溢出时没有生成内存快照,特别是对于那种JVM已经崩溃或者错误出现在顺利运行了数小时甚至数天的生产系统上时,将很难去分析崩溃问题...我们可以通过设置 -XX:+HeapDumpOnOutOfMemoryError 让JVM在发生内存溢出时自动的生成堆内存快照。有了这个参数,当我们不得不面对内存溢出异常的时候会节约大量的时间。

16700

session的生命周期

Session存储在服务器端,一般为了防止在服务器内存中(为了高速存取),Sessinon在用户访问第一次访问服务器时创建,需要注意只有访问JSP、Servlet等程序时才会创建Session,访问...服务器会把长时间没有活动的Session从服务器内存中清除,此时Session便失效。Tomcat中Session的默认失效时间为30分钟。   2....Session对浏览器的要求:  虽然Session保存在服务器,对客户端是透明的,它的正常运行仍然需要客户端浏览器的支持。这是因为Session需要使用Cookie作为识别标志。...Session依据该Cookie来识别是否为同一用户。   该Cookie为服务器自动生成的,它的maxAge属性一般为-1,表示仅当前浏览器内有效,并且各浏览器窗口间不共享,关闭浏览器就会失效。...当第二次访问时服务器已经在浏览器中写入Cookie了,因此URL地址重写后的地址中就不会带有jsessionid了。

26710

麻省理工开发出低功耗语音识别技术

物联网的构想是,交通工具、电器装置、土木工程建筑、生产设备、甚至家禽等都会装上传感器,这些传感器会直接将相关信息发送给联网的服务器,并由后者来协助完成维护保养和任务调度。...语音识别网络体积太大,不能载入到芯片的内存里,问题就来了:从芯片外存储器中读取数据到芯片中比从芯片自己的存储中读取数据更耗能。...减少芯片内存带宽的第一步就是压缩每个节点相关的权重值。数据只有放到芯片里后才会进行解压。 芯片还利用了语音识别的一个特有性质:一波又一波的数据必须通过网络。...这种芯片每一次载入神经网络的一个节点,但这个节点要传递32个连续的10毫秒增量数据。 如果一个节点有12个输出,那么这32个传递数据便会得到384个输出值,存放在芯片内存中。...因此,该芯片也要求具备一定规模的片上内存电路来进行中间计算。芯片每次从芯片外存储器中读取一个压缩节点,这样就保持了较低的能耗需求。

84350

10-Servlet

Servlet 概念 运行在服务器端的小程序 Servlet就是一个接口,定义了Java类被浏览器访问到(tomcat识别)的规则 基本步骤 创建JavaEE项目 定义一个类,实现Servlet接口...如果有,则再找到对应的全类名 tomcat会将字节码文件加载进内存,并且创建其对象 调用其方法 声明周期 1....被创建时 执行init方法,且执行一次,一般用于加载资源 Servlet被创建的时机 默认情况下,在第一次访问时被创建 可以通过配置Servlet修改创建时机 配置标签下的标签(值为正数则在启动服务器时就被创建...,值为负数,则在第一次访问时创建,默认值为-1) Servlet的init方法执行一次,说明一个Servlet在内存存在一个对象,即Servlet是单例的。...被销毁时 调用destroy方法,在被销毁时执行一次,且必须是正常销毁,强制销毁时同样不执行。

25720

安全测试丨慢速攻击的三种形式和防护思路

攻击者通过发送大量的半开连接请求到目标服务器,每个连接请求发送少量的数据,并长时间保持连接不断开。...由于这种攻击方式发送的请求都是合法的,因此很难被传统的防火墙或入侵检测系统所识别。同时,慢速攻击还可以与其他攻击方式相结合,形成更为复杂的攻击链,进一步提高攻击的成功率和隐蔽性。...HTTP慢速攻击的特点隐蔽性高:慢速攻击利用的是HTTP协议的合法特性,因此很难被传统的安全设备所识别。占用资源少:每个慢速连接发送少量的数据,因此攻击者可以使用较少的资源发起大量的攻击。...Window到服务器,直到连接快超时前才读取一个字节,这样方式以消耗服务器的连接和内存资源。...攻击者就是利用了这点,对服务器发起一个HTTP请求,一直不停的发送HTTP头部,但是HTTP头字段不发送结束符,之后发送其他字段,而服务器在处理之前需要先接收完所有的HTTP头部,导致连接一直被占用,这样就消耗了服务器的连接和内存资源

23100

【FusionCompute】创建虚拟机失败(六)

配置虚拟机,设置虚拟机的CPU大小、内存大小、磁盘大小、网卡等相应参数。 确认参数信息。单击“确定”。 提示创建“成功”。但是未能正常开启。...例如,添加安装VRM报错、添加CNA主机报错、识别不出本次虚拟磁盘、没有内存信息显示等。...刚开始,使用基于FusionCompute 8.0.0版本的虚拟化套件,进行实验的,但是在VM虚拟环境,安装部署过程中,支持CNA主机的安装,使用FusionCompute 安装工具进行VRM管理节点的安装...在部署虚拟存储过程中,基于FreeNAS系统创建了iSCSI存储,能够识别并添加成功。但是识别不了本次虚拟磁盘和内存信息。添加虚拟机最终也以失败告终。...建议:在安装部署FusionCompute虚拟化套件时,最好使用物理服务器进行实验操作,体验效果最佳。

2.4K20

Linux 透明大页 THP 和标准大页 HP

144G 的虚拟内存,甚至比 SGA 还大。...然而,透明的HugePages可能会导致内存分配的延迟,因为内存是动态分配的。因此,Oracle 建议在所有 Oracle 数据库服务器上禁用透明大页,以避免性能问题。...查看页面大小 首先查看 Hugepagesize,一般 x86 服务器为 2 M, Linuxone 系统为 1M 大小,不同的内核版本 Hugepage 页面大小可能不一样,也有 4M–256M 等其他大小的...然后检查 /proc/meminfo,如果HugePages_Total 小于设置的数量,那么表明没有足够的连续物理内存用于这些标准大页,需要重启服务器。...然后重新以oracle用户连接到数据库服务器,使用 ulimit -l 命令,可以看到: max lockedmemory (kbytes, -l) 33587200 不过为了省事,我一般将

2.4K20

JVM 之 GC 算法分析

垃圾回收算法的原理垃圾回收算法的核心思想是识别出哪些对象是“垃圾”,即不再被程序所使用,从而可以将这些对象从内存中回收。垃圾回收算法的实现过程可以分为两个主要步骤:标记和清理。...复制算法(Copying)复制算法将堆分为两个区域,每次使用其中一个区域。当该区域用完后,将该区域中的存活对象复制到另一个区域,然后再清除该区域的所有对象。...该算法的优点是不会产生内存碎片,但是需要额外的空间进行复制。该算法适用于内存较大的情况,如服务器端应用程序。...但是,在清理阶段,该算法将所有存活的对象移动到内存的一端,然后再清除端边界以外的内存。该算法的优点是不会产生内存碎片,但是需要移动对象,开销较大。该算法适用于内存较大的情况,如服务器端应用程序。...标记 - 清除算法:适用于内存较小的情况,如嵌入式系统等。 复制算法:适用于内存较大的情况,如服务器端应用程序。 标记 - 整理算法:适用于内存较大的情况,如服务器端应用程序。

12010

Session会话与Cookie简单说明

为了获得更高的存取速度,服务器一般把Session放在内存里。每个用户都会有一个独立的Session。如果Session内容过于复杂,当大量客户访问服务器时可能会导致内存溢出。...Session在用户第一次访问服务器的时候自动创建。需要注意只有访问JSP、Servlet等程序时才会创建Session,访问HTML、IMAGE等静态资源并不会创建Session。...Session的有效期 由于会有越来越多的用户访问服务器,因此Session也会越来越多。为防止内存溢出,服务器会把长时间内没有活跃的Session从内存删除。这个时间就是Session的超时时间。...所有这些东西存在的原因在于识别出用户来,这样当用户写评论或者发推时,服务器能知道是谁在发评论,是谁在发推。当用户登录后,会产生一个包含会话 id 的 cookie。...其他 1) 由于Http协议是无状态的,服务端如何识别客户端请求呢,只能依靠http报文中新增部分头字段来实现请求识别(如何在请求body或这参数中设置会员参数,服务器端会话就与自定义的会员识别绑定到一起

1.7K70

了解 Session、LocatStorage、Cache-Control、ETag

在服务端保存 Session 的方法很多,内存、数据库、文件都有。...集群的时候也要考虑 Session 的转移,在大型的网站,一般会有专门的 Session 服务器集群,用来保存用户会话,这个时候 Session 信息都是放在内存的,使用一些缓存服务比如 Memcached...思考一下服务端如何识别特定的客户?这个时候 Cookie 就登场了。每次 HTTP 请求的时候,客户端都会发送相应的 Cookie 信息到服务端。...一般这种情况下,会使用一种叫做 URL 重写的技术来进行会话跟踪,即每次 HTTP 交互,URL 后面都会被附加上一个诸如 sid=xxxxx 这样的参数,服务端据此来识别用户。...服务器通过 cookie 给用户一个 sessionID,sessionID 对应服务器里的一小块内存,每次用户访问服务器的时候,服务器就通过 sessionID 去读取对应的 session,来知道用户的隐私信息面试的时候怎么回答

82550
领券